What is the Disability Certificate?
The Disability Certificate is a crucial document issued in India to officially certify an individual's disability status. It plays a significant role in validating the extent and type of disability a person has and contains essential personal information, including the individual's name and contact details. This certification is important for accessing various services and benefits specifically designed for persons with disabilities.
The Disability Certificate includes key details such as the nature of the disability, its severity, and necessary signatures from both the issuing medical authority and the individual with a disability. Through this certificate, individuals can access government services, financial assistance, and healthcare benefits.

Who Needs a Disability Certificate?
Several groups of individuals may require a Disability Certificate. This includes persons with disabilities, caregivers who support them, and parents of minors who have disabilities. Each of these individuals may need the certificate for various situations, such as enrolling in educational programs or applying for government assistance.
Examples of scenarios where a Disability Certificate is necessary include applying for disability pensions, securing healthcare services, and positioning for job opportunities catered to individuals with disabilities.
Eligibility Criteria for the Disability Certificate
To successfully apply for a Disability Certificate in India, certain eligibility criteria must be met. Applicants are required to provide specific medical documentation that substantiates the existence and extent of their disability. This medical assessment must be conducted by an authorized medical professional.
-
Proof of identity and residence
-
Medical reports indicating the nature of disability
-
Assessment conducted by a recognized medical authority

Who is eligible to receive a Disability Certificate?
Individuals with recognized disabilities as defined by government guidelines are eligible for a Disability Certificate. A medical assessment must confirm the disability to complete the certification process.
What documents do I need to submit with the form?
Typically, you need to provide identification proof, medical reports detailing your condition, and any previous disability assessments. Check specific requirements as they may vary by state.
How long does it take to process the Disability Certificate?
Processing times can vary but generally range from a few days to several weeks, depending on the medical authority's workload and the complexity of the case.

Is there a fee associated with obtaining a Disability Certificate?
In many cases, there is no fee for obtaining a Disability Certificate as it is a government form. However, some jurisdictions may charge nominal fees for processing.
Can a caregiver apply for the Disability Certificate on behalf of a person with a disability?
Yes, a caregiver can assist in the application process but must ensure that the person with a disability provides necessary information and consents to the application.
